German wind turbine manufacturer Nordex SE has appointed Manav Sharma as the CEO of its North American operations, aiming to lead the expansion of its business in the US. Sharma, who currently serves as Nordex’s Chief Transformation Officer and previously was its Chief Operations Officer, will take over from John McComas. The expansion of local supply chains in US will ensure US customers continue to benefit from local manufacturing credit. This will enable the company to take advantage of anticipated market growth. In 2023, Europe accounted for 86% of Nordex’s total order volume, while North America, including Canada, made up 4%.
